At the heart of Laser Industries' capabilities is their state-of-the-art water jet cutting technology. This allows the company to precisely cut a wide variety of materials, including metals, plastics, composites, and even some ceramics, without generating heat that could cause warping, melting, or other damage. This makes water jet cutting an ideal choice for many applications where other cutting methods would be unsuitable.
